Dr. Santiago Munoz, MD, FACP, FACG, FAASLD
Dr. Santiago Munoz is the Medical Director of Liver Transplant and the Center for Liver Disease at Tower Health Transplant Institute. With over 30 years of experience in hepatology and liver transplantation, he is a Fellow of the American College of Physicians (FACP), American College of Gastroenterology (FACG), and American Association for the Study of Liver Diseases (FAASLD). Dr. Munoz has extensive expertise in hepatitis, liver failure, and cirrhosis, and has been instrumental in advancing treatment protocols for hepatorenal syndrome.
